Rapper arrested for selling party drugs

CITY OF SAN FERNANDO -- A social media sensation and rap artist was arrested by the Philippine Drug Enforcement Agency (PDEA)-Central Luzon over the weekend for alleged involvement in the proliferation of illegal drugs.

PDEA-Central Luzon Director Gil Pabilona said the suspect, identified as Arnly Dimabuyu, famously known as “Xander Bay”, was arrested in an anti-illegal drug operation launched in front of a bar in Friendship Hi-way, Barangay Cut-cut, Angeles City.

Dimabuyu, known for his “hugot” videos and fliptop (rap battle) videos on Youtube, is considered a high-value target due to allegedly being a source of marijuana and various party drugs to his followers.

Seized from Dimabuyu were a sachet containing five grams of marijuana and nine pieces of pink ecstasy with an estimated street value of P15,900.00 and the buy-bust money.

The suspect is now detained in PDEA jail facility while charges for violation of RA 9165 Section 5 (sale of dangerous drugs) and Section 11 (possession of dangerous drugs) are being prepared against him.
